Sexy Meal Plan Tip – Eating breakfast is so important in losing weight. You need a healthy breakfast to jump start your metabolism and keep you energized for the rest of the day. Here's another great recipe from fitnessmagazine.com:

Vanilla Spice French Toast with Apple
Ingredients:
* 1 egg plus 2 egg whites
* 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
* Dash each of cinnamon and nutmeg
* 2 pieces whole-grain bread
* 1/2 medium apple, sliced

Make it: Whisk eggs, vanilla, and spices together. Dip bread into egg mixture. Spray skillet with cooking spray and saute bread on each side until brown (about 3 minutes). Top with apple slices.

Oh, wait, I need to tell you this first. You really shouldn't weigh yourself every day. At the most, every week, but it's best to weigh yourself once a month, in the morning and in your birthday suit. Weight will fluctuate and weighing yourself everyday can make you frustrated and more likely cause you to give up.
